Whatsapp

nnn

Anonim

nnn egy terminál fájlböngésző, amely nagy hangsúlyt fektet a terminál és az asztali környezet közötti szakadék áthidalására. Az első kiadás néhány napja jelent meg, és néhány hatékony funkciót hoz magával.

nnn a noice-ra épít, egy nagyon gyors, de minimális funkcionalitású terminálfájlböngészőre. Történelmileg a terminálról ismert volt, hogy a fejlesztők és a hackerek kedvenc médiuma az operációs rendszerrel való interakcióhoz.

A rendszeres asztali felhasználók azonban inkább a grafikus felhasználói felület alrendszert részesítik előnyben. nnn összhangba hozza a terminált és a grafikus felhasználói felületet, lehetővé téve, hogy az asztali megnyitó átvegye az irányítást mindenféle fájl teljes vagy szelektív megnyitása felett. És ez még csak a kezdet!

nnn – Terminálfájlböngésző

A nnn legjobb része az, hogy a felhasználóknak nem kell túl sok parancsikont megjegyezniük az induláshoz. A navigációt egyszerűnek tervezték, az átlagos asztali felhasználó számára már ismerős billentyűparancsokkal, például a nyilak, Enter, Home, End, Page Up/Down stb.

nnn írta Arun Prakash Jana, a szerző olyan népszerű parancssori segédprogramok közül, mint a googler, Buku, imgp stb.

Az nnn jellemzői

nnn – Lemezhasználatot mutató fájlböngésző

Az nnn fejlesztője érdekes döntéseket hoz:

nnn – Fájlinformációk megjelenítése

nnn erős fejlesztés alatt áll, és Ön hozzájárulhat új funkciókhoz, vagy megvitathatja azokat, amelyeket látni szeretne a projekt ToDo listáján.

Környezeti változók

NNN_OPENER: hagyja, hogy egy asztali nyitó kezelje az egészet. Például.:

export NNN_OPENER=xdg-open
"export NNN_OPENER=gio nyitva"
export NNN_OPENER=gvfs-open

NNN_FALLBACK_OPENER: Az nnn előre meghatároz néhány statikus asszociációt a népszerű fájltípusokhoz az mpv, vi és zathura (PDF-ekhez). A statikus társításnak nincs hatása, ha a NNN_OPENER be van állítva.

Ha azonban ezek a kedvenc alkalmazásai, beállíthatja az asztali megnyitót a NNN_FALLBACK_OPENER értékre, hogy kezelje a többi fájlt. Például.:

export NNN_FALLBACK_OPENER=xdg-open
"export NNN_FALLBACK_OPENER=gio nyitva"
export NNN_FALLBACK_OPENER=gvfs-open

NNN_DE_FILE_MANAGER: állítsa be az asztali fájlkezelőt a o gombbal történő megnyitáshoz. Például.:

export NNN_DE_FILE_MANAGER=thunar

NNN_COPIER: állítson be egy szkriptet, amely a ^Kbillentyűt, és másolja ki az aktuális fájl elérési útját. Példa szkript (Linuxhoz):

!/bin/sh
echo -n $1 | xsel --clipboard --input

Az nnn telepítése Linux alatt

Az Ubuntu (és származékai) telepítéséhez futtassa:

$ sudo add-apt-repository ppa:twodopeshaggy/jarun
$ sudo apt-get frissítés
$ sudo apt-get install nnn

Az Arch Linux felhasználók telepíthetik az nnn-t az AUR-ból.

A felhasználók a forrásból is lefordíthatják és telepíthetik az nnn fájlt. Az nnn C-ben van írva. Az egyetlen függőség az ncurses libray.

Az nnn használata Linuxban

nnn 3 különböző nézeti módban indulhat (futás közben billentyűparancsokkal váltható):

Start módok

1 perces beállítás

Telepítse az nnn elemet a kívánt módban, vagy állítsa be az nnn elemet a részletes nézet módban való megnyitásához a hozzáadással.

alias n='nnn -d'

a shell rc fájljába (pl. ~/.bashrc a bash számára).

Következtetés

nnn azoknak a felhasználóknak szól, akik a terminál kényelméből szeretnék élvezni az asztali számítógép elérhetőségét. A legördülő terminált használók profitálnának a legjobban, mert a terminál megtartaná a folyamatban lévő munkák kontextusát is. Próbálja ki, és mondja el nekünk visszajelzését!

Ezt a tippet az alkalmazás fejlesztője küldte be, ha van ilyen terméke vagy tippje, ossza meg velünk itt.